Public records show 35, Lichfield Road, Burntwood to be a mid-century freehold house with 678 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 351 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
35, Lichfield Road, Burntwood has an estimated sale value of £247,800 and an estimated rental value of £1,097 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.
Lichfield Road, Burntwood, WS7 lies in the borough of Lichfield, within the WS7 postal district.

Price Range & Condition
In very good condition, we estimate 35, Lichfield Road, Burntwood would be worth £260,190, with a potential rental value of £1,152 per month.
If substantial cosmetic improvements are needed, the estimated sale value falls to £230,454, with a rental value of £1,020 per month.
The extent to which decoration affects a property's value depends on its type, size and location.
Recent Market Change
The estimated sale value of 35, Lichfield Road, Burntwood has grown by £4,514 (1.8%) over the last year. During the same period, its estimated monthly rental value has climbed by £51 (4.7%). The property's estimated gross yield is currently 5.3%.

Energy Efficiency
35, Lichfield Road, Burntwood has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 26 May 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
35, Lichfield Road, Burntwood last changed hands on 12th April 2017, selling for £195,000. The transaction was logged as a freehold house by HM Land Registry.
That is its only recorded sale since 1995.
The market for similar properties has risen by 2.9% since April 2017.
